Henry Goldsmith ( Hines Goldschmitt)

Born March 14, 1923, Died May 3, 2001.

Henry wrote "My First Life" about his life before and during and after the Holocaust. How he survived those years not as a victim but how he used his courage, luck, and instinct to live a life that aloud him the escape, to work for the French Resentence in the German V-2 program, smuggling guns and other fighters under the noses of the Germans. In fighting back to help bring down the Nazis. He survive the infamous Buchenwald concentration camp. Travel post war making a few dollars and finding and then lousing love at the end. This is his remarkable story of his First Life. Hold your breath and follow Henry on his journey.
